MySQL中類型無符號的作用
MySQL是一種關系型數據庫管理系統。在數據存儲和處理過程中,數據類型無疑是非常重要的一個方面。除了基礎數據類型如整型、浮點型、字符型等,MySQL還提供了一種無符號類型。在MySQL中,數據類型被定義為有符號或無符號。數據類型無符號的主要作用是擴大數值范圍。
數據類型無符號在MySQL中的使用
無符號類型是一種基本數據類型,可以衍生出多個相關類型。在MySQL中,無符號類型主要有以下四種:無符號整型、無符號小整型、無符號中整型、無符號大整型。無符號類型的數值范圍比有符號類型更大。以無符號整型為例,其數值范圍為0~4,294,967,295,而有符號整型的數值范圍為–2,147,483,648~2,147,483,647。
無符號類型在MySQL中的應用
無符號類型可以在MySQL中的很多應用場景下發揮作用。比如,當使用ENUM字段類型時,無符號類型可以用于將列值轉換為數字碼,這對于提高查詢速度非常有用。另外,還可以將無符號類型用于財務相關性能分析數據。如果你需要制定一份年度經濟報告,就需要對各行業的年度數據進行比較。在這種情況下,使用無符號類型可以充分利用計算機的處理能力,提高數據處理的速度。
總結
MySQL中的無符號類型可以擴大數值范圍,并在一些特定的場景下發揮其作用。但是,在使用無符號類型時,一定要注意數值范圍的大小和數據類型的選擇,否則會導致數據的不準確和計算錯誤。